Between the gill net ban, 3 miles from shore, and the Hubb's restocking program is what (IMHO and educated one as well) has allowed sport fisherman the successes as we enjoyed in the '50&60's, now. Going to a 3 fish limit and 1 in spawning season(even for the commercial guys) was huge, also. I've been around this game a very long time and anything I can do to help with my chances of catching a 60-70 pounder & help with the substantion of the species for the future fisherman/fisherwoman -- I'm all in! Even this 40#'der is an awesome catch! It would of made the cover of WON back in the days when I see was growing up. Now a days, it is almost an average sized catch...
I worked at the 'Harbor Fish Market' in Oceanside, in the early through late '70's. I witness the only ones catching large c-bass and huge halibut on a daily basis, where the gill netters...
I haven't caught as many Cbass as of late, however the ones I have the good fortune to catch, I take to Hubb's. There facility is fascinating and so cool. I encourage anyone who hasn't taken a tour - to do so!
